Factors to Consider Before Hiring
Did you know that proper furnace installation doesn’t just improve your comfort—it also impacts your energy efficiency and the lifespan of your system? Here are a few key factors to consider.
1. Your Budget
The cost of a furnace and installation can vary significantly, whether you are upgrading or replacing an old unit. Be sure to request detailed quotes to compare costs effectively.
Remember that while cheaper options may save money upfront, they could cost more in the long run due to inefficiency or frequent repairs.
2. Energy Efficiency
Choosing an energy-efficient furnace can save you hundreds on utility bills each year. Search for models with a high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ency (AFUE) ratings; for instance, a 90% AFUE furnace means 90% of the fuel is converted into heat. Modern systems often include smart features like programmable thermostats, which can also make a big difference.
3. Your Home’s Size and Heating Needs
Before shopping, take stock of your home's size, layout, and insulation. Too small of a unit won’t keep your house warm, while an oversized furnace can cause inefficiency and wear out faster. A professional HVAC technician can calculate heat load to find the perfect fit for your home.
Finding a Qualified Professional
Hiring the right professional is arguably the most critical step in the furnace installation. The wrong installer can leave you with a system that doesn’t function properly or poses safety risks. Here’s how to ensure the job’s done right.
1. Research Local Contractors
Look for licensed and insured HVAC companies in Toms River. Review their websites, read reviews on Google or Yelp, and check out platforms like the Better Business Bureau (BBB) to see if they’re in good standing.
2. Verify Credentials
Ask for proof of licenses, certifications, and insurance. The most reputable contractors will have credentials like NATE (North American Technician Excellence) certification, which ensures they meet industry standards.
3. Request Estimates
Get at least three quotes for your furnace and installation. Detailed quotes will break down costs for equipment, labor, and additional fees. Beware of estimates that seem too good to be true—they often are.
4. Ask the Right Questions
How much experience do you have with furnace installation?
Do you guarantee your work?
Will you be obtaining permits for the installation? Compliance ensures your system is installed to code.
What Happens During the Installation Process?
The process might seem daunting if you’ve never installed a furnace before. Here’s what usually happens on installation day so you’ll know what to expect.
Step 1: Inspection and Preparation

The technician will first inspect your home to ensure everything is prepped for proper installation, including checking ductwork and ventilation.
Step 2: Removing the Old Furnace
The old unit will be carefully disconnected and removed. Don’t worry; professionals will ensure that this is done safely without damaging your home.
Step 3: Installing the New Furnace
Once the space is ready, the new furnace is installed. The technician will ensure it’s positioned correctly and connected to all necessary systems, including gas or electrical lines, ductwork, and the thermostat.
Step 4: Testing and Calibration
After the installation, the technician will test the system, adjusting airflow and calibrating the thermostat to ensure smooth operation. They will also guide you through operating the unit.
Can a Gas Furnace Be Installed Outside?
It’s a question many homeowners ask, and the answer isn’t as straightforward as you might think.
Yes, gas furnaces can be installed outside, but they’re uncommon in residential settings. Outdoor models—often packaged units—are more common for commercial buildings or homes with limited indoor space. These systems are designed to withstand the elements and work as efficiently as indoor models.
If you’re curious whether an outdoor furnace might be right for your home, ask your HVAC professional for advice based on your specific setup and heating needs.
